
Cost of Cement Pad Construction in Joplin
Constructing a cement pad in Joplin, MO, involves several considerations that can influence the overall cost. Whether you're planning to build a patio, driveway, or foundation, understanding these factors can help you budget more effectively.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Pad: Larger pads require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Thickness of the Pad: Thicker pads provide more durability but also require more cement and reinforcement.
- Type of Cement: Different types of cement vary in price and suitability for specific applications.
- Site Preparation: Costs can rise if the site requires extensive grading, excavation, or removal of existing structures.
- Reinforcement Materials: Adding rebar or wire mesh for extra strength will add to the c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Joplin, MO, can vary based on the complexity of the job and the contractor's experience.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, which come with additional fees.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ay construction and increase labor costs.

Task | Average Cost in Joplin, MO |
---|---|
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 |
Cement Pad (per square foot) | $5 - $10 |
Reinforcement Materials | $0.50 - $1 per square foot |
Labor | $50 - $100 per hour |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$500 |
Total Average Cost | $2,000 - $5,000 |
